STARS Mentoring Project  
 
Tucson, AZ 85716

There are approximately 38,000 children in Pima County who have at least one incarcerated parent in jail or prison. These children may not have same the resources as other children, and life can feel very confusing. STARS Mentoring Project provides caring adult mentors to children of incarcerated parents, ages 6-18. more
